QUOTE (august_milan @ Mar 18 2008, 09:18 PM)
if both clubs cant reach an agreement then it goes to envelopes? what does this mean and how is the probelm resolved? thanks
*


It means both teams will make their bids, put it in an envelope and submit it. The amount of the bid remains confidential and will not be known to the other team until the envelopes are opened. Once the envelopes are opened, whichever team that has made the higher bid, signs the player.
